Transaction 18894c57103c3addc5cbbfe645d092d4d7bd097616140c090ccde4dc24ad7294

2 Input
2 Outputs
  • 18894c57103c3addc5cbbfe645d092d4d7bd097616140c090ccde4dc24ad7294:0
  • value  29180148
    address  1DSRrtter1nFfagshUwjN7XnmjSzRhvk61
  • 18894c57103c3addc5cbbfe645d092d4d7bd097616140c090ccde4dc24ad7294:1
  • value  1063473
    address  3Fdsb8gq5wSRbCUFnYt1FAqzo5GBtuc64t